8192Oracle的超级进化(8192 oracle)
8192:Oracle的超级进化
自Oracle首次发布数据库管理系统(DBMS)以来,这个领先的技术公司已经经历了许多变革和进化。然而,在所有这些变化中,最大的一次可能就是Oracle 8192的发布。这个版本的旋转式更改完全改变了Oracle DBMS的工作方式和功能。
从性能和可伸缩性的角度来看,Oracle 8192是Oracle DBMS领域的超级英雄。这个版本利用了现代硬件的优势,它引入了多线程查询引擎(MTQE)。MTQE实质上是一个多核心CPU之间的协调器,使得查询变得高度并行化。更直接地说,它可以同时执行多个查询。
MTQE是Oracle 8192中最引人注目的功能之一,但它远不是唯一的一个。Oracle还引入了新的内存访问机制,这个机制增加了内存使用效率并提高了性能。此外,Oracle 8192支持自动缓存管理和可扩展缓存带宽的“自适应缓存”功能。
除此之外,Oracle 8192还通过引入分区表和分区索引来增强数据访问的效率和可扩展性。分区是将表和索引分解为更小的部分,以便可以单独查询它们。这使得存储和处理大型数据集更加容易,并优化了性能。
在安全性方面,Oracle 8192也是一个巨大的飞跃。它支持所有主流的身份验证和授权协议,包括Kerberos、LDAP、PKI和OAuth。此外,它还提供强制访问控制(MAC)和标签安全保护,这使得Oracle数据变得更加安全。
Oracle 8192具有不同寻常的高性能,可伸缩性和安全性,因此在企业和政府机构中得到广泛应用。作为Oracle DBMS的最新版本,它允许数据库管理员轻松地提高数据库处理的效率,并确保数据的安全性。这些功能的整合和升级已经让Oracle DBMS超越了竞争对手,成为数据库管理系列的领导者。
以下是一些Oracle 8192的简单示例代码:
创建分区表:
CREATE TABLE sales (
time_id DATE,
sales_id NUMBER(10),
amount NUMBER(10),
region VARCHAR2(10)
)
PARTITION BY RANGE (time_id)
(
PARTITION sales_q1_2000 VALUES LESS THAN (TO_DATE(’01-APR-2000′,’DD-MON-YYYY’)),
PARTITION sales_q2_2000 VALUES LESS THAN (TO_DATE(’01-JUL-2000′,’DD-MON-YYYY’)),
PARTITION sales_q3_2000 VALUES LESS THAN (TO_DATE(’01-OCT-2000′,’DD-MON-YYYY’)),
PARTITION sales_q4_2000 VALUES LESS THAN (TO_DATE(’01-JAN-2001′,’DD-MON-YYYY’)),
PARTITION sales_q1_2001 VALUES LESS THAN (TO_DATE(’01-APR-2001′,’DD-MON-YYYY’))
);
查询分区表:
SELECT *
FROM sales
PARTITION (sales_q1_2000);